Thousand Oaks delays decision on city branding contract

A contract with a Nashville-based company to develop a branding project for the city of Thousand Oaks was set aside for 60 days by the City Council at its meeting on Jan. 13. The council voted 5-0 to delay a decision on an $89,000 contract with North Star Destination Strategies and instead approved the creation of a committee, comprised of council Members Andy Fox and Jacqui Irwin, to further study the issue.
